Just now, the UK declared war on me, Yugoslavia, for seemingly no reason. I had eliminated all separatist spirits, built a decent army, signed non-aggression pacts with my aggressive neighbors (thank you, agents!), and was working on expanding and upgrading my army for the inevitable German attack once the pact expired, having rejected their demands to submit. UK, France, and Romania all guarantee me, and Germany is already at war with UK, France, and USSR, so I'm feeling optimistic about the future...

...and then the UK declares war for absolutely no reason. I had received an event where they stated that my "continued trade" with Germany was considered a hostile action, but I wasn't trading with Germany. In fact, I had made a conscious effort to never trade with the Germans. In fact, I was purchasing large amounts of steel and rubber from the UK. In fact, the Germans had a war goal on me at that very moment.

But nope, Churchill decides to attack me for no discernible reason. Is it because I wasn't at war with the Axis and/or in the Allies? And why exactly can Germany take the focus that grants them a wargoal, when a non-aggression pact stops them in their tracks? Shouldn't the focus be locked until it's gone?

Does anyone know what on the UK tree is causing this? I've seen it happen a few times recently while playing as various countries looking to use guarantees on Yugo as backdoors into wars with Germany and Italy, and I've always had my plans scuppered by the UK shouting "Surprise!" and declaring war on them before Germany or Italy do.

Its not a focus on the tree but rather the British version of the German event. When Austria is annexed Germany and Britain will get an event to pressure Yugoslavia. The event has several time periods where it can continue with the pressure usually leading to an instant war declaration, as in war is declared immediately at the end of the event chain.

The British Version it similar except that in Historical the first event is as far as it will go,

Well, historically the UK did put pressure on Yugoslavia to enter the war on allies side and wouldn't accept neutrality from them. Germany did accept neutrality from Yugoslavia if they did join the Tripartite Pact in name only. So Prince Paul did so in the end ( despite being pro allies ) and the UK did encourage a coup against the regent to put the young king in place + a new government which would refuse to sign the tripartite pact ( and maybe join the allies ) which prompted Germany to invade Yugoslavia in the end despite it not being planned.


I guess the way the game is made is you signing a non aggression pact with Germany meant you joined the Tripartite Pact which prompted hostility from the UK.

Does anyone know what on the UK tree is causing this? I've seen it happen a few times recently while playing as various countries looking to use guarantees on Yugo as backdoors into wars with Germany and Italy, and I've always had my plans scuppered by the UK shouting "Surprise!" and declaring war on them before Germany or Italy do.
There's a chain of British events that can send a 'demand' to Yugoslavia (demand in inverted commas here because Yugoslavia doesn't actually get the option to do anything in response, just a one-option event noting that the Brits are making demands).

Short version (assuming I'm reading the event files correctly), if the UK is Democratic, at war with Germany, and Historical Focuses is not on, then there's an 81% chance that they will declare war with Yugoslavia eventually (I think there's a delay of minimum six months and maximum two-and-a-half years, but I'm not 100% sure how the time delay for triggering events works).

The only reasonable way to stop the event is for Yugoslavia to join a faction before the war declaration or pray for the UK to break the chain on it's own (as noted, only a 19% chance for this). If Yugoslavia is at war with Germany before the UK is, that also works - but this only stops the first event which should fire within about 4 days of the UK going to war. Once that's happened, Yugoslavia going to war with Germany will not stop the second event that actually triggers the UK declaring war.

Otherwise, the event will also stop if the UK isn't democratic, doesn't exist, isn't at war with Germany anymore, or Yugoslavia doesn't exist, but obviously those are ... less than practical as workarounds.
